Mechanism of Action
Functions as a comprehensive skin protectant by neutralizing reactive oxygen species through its high concentration of flavonoids, tannins, and alkaloids. The extract inhibits key enzymes including acetylcholinesterase and lipase while protecting structural proteins like collagen and elastin from oxidative damage, simultaneously providing mild astringent and anti-inflammatory effects.

Key findings
- 01 Demonstrated significant ROS reduction at 5.0-10.0 µg/mL concentrations with strong antioxidant activity
- 02 Effective enzyme inhibition observed at 44.1-49.16 µg/mL for anti-aging applications
- 03 Industry usage data supports 0.5-1.0% for facial care with irritation-soothing benefits

Stability
Demonstrates optimal stability in anhydrous systems and oil phases of emulsions, with phenolic components vulnerable to degradation under extreme pH conditions
Conflicts
- Strong oxidizing agents
- Strongly alkaline environments (pH > 8.0)
- High temperature processing
Safety
Safety Profile
CIR Expert Panel noted insufficient safety data in 2023, though IFRA guidelines suggest 8% maximum for fragrance applications. Contains trace allergens benzyl benzoate and benzyl alcohol below 0.05%.
